Model details
GPT-5.3-Codex-Spark is a specialized, smaller-scale iteration of the GPT-5.3-Codex architecture, engineered specifically to prioritize responsiveness in software development environments. While many AI assistants function as external chat interfaces, this model is built to integrate directly into the developer's workflow, allowing for immediate, targeted edits and rapid logic adjustments. By focusing on low-latency performance, it enables a more fluid, iterative experience where developers can refine interfaces and debug code with near-instant feedback, bridging the gap between autonomous, long-running tasks and the need for immediate, hands-on control.
Developed as the first milestone in a strategic partnership with Cerebras, the model leverages specialized wafer-scale hardware to achieve speeds exceeding 1,000 tokens per second. This optimization ensures that the model remains highly capable for real-world coding tasks while maintaining the high-speed throughput necessary for live, in-editor interaction. As a research preview, it serves as a testing ground for high-performance inference, allowing developers to experiment with rapid iteration cycles across large codebases and complex modules before the deployment of larger, more resource-intensive frontier models.

OpenAI on Thursday released GPT-5.3-Codex-Spark, its first AI model served on chips from Cerebras Systems, marking the ChatGPT maker’s first production deployment on non-Nvidia silicon.
